Transaction 42bdea237965fa261d5a7bd74c4898e75c1c07ae7ec5d6eea613c15cee061998

1 Input
1 Outputs
  • 42bdea237965fa261d5a7bd74c4898e75c1c07ae7ec5d6eea613c15cee061998:0
  • value  954675
    address  3Dju4aFtHqaueJ5GUYv9zmvDDM8M7wAexX